    Concept:
    roughly 30" wide hulls with a single berth and another compartment for either a generator or a small galley (one per side), a center cuddy cabin big enough for a small double berth, head (composting not trad. marine), & helm. Under the cuddy would be a rail system like under a kitchen table that would allow the cuddy to open in the middle and panels placed in the opening. There would be 2 support beams, the normal one close to the bow and another one behind the cuddy. They would be bolt in and would have two sets of receiver brackets. One on the freeboard for when opened up and the other on the deck for when closed. This should allow for the same beam to be used for support in both open and closed positions. Opening and closing would be limited to calm waters or docked situations.


    Current Progress:

    First hull

    I went with a 6" flat bottom that goes into a shallow V that rises 1" for every 3" and runs to a 24" width where it is 3" up from the flat. I then connected that point to a point 24" up from the bottom and 30 inches wide. In the first 5 ft, I brought the bottom up from 24" to 9" and the width from 30" to 3" and I plan on capping and shaping the nose after sheeting. The pics will show where ive gotten to.
    The longitudinal stringers are missing a few because I am still kicking around whether I should use a 10 ft piece of 1x4 right in the middle. This would then be a stiff, weight distributed spot to tie the beam supports together at the lowest level. They also were not necessary to keep the frame square and it gave me a little more room to reach around.
    I didn't know exactly what the dimensions would look like after bending the stringers so the nose piece is missing a few pieces yet. The bent stringers are pulling the front 2 ft or so out of position so I was going to get the side pieces of ply laid out and cut and then temporarily tack them in place to hold everything racked while I fill in the rest of the nose support. Once those pieces are in place, when I remove the ply everything should sit like it should.
    Then I will finish the stern/transom. I am trying to figure out if this will be worth keeping a flatish bottom all the way to the transom in an attempt at planing or whether I should forget about achieving plane and pull the bottom up over a couple feet. Upside to that is more water flow around the prop at a shallower depth.

    Have you carefully calculated the all up weight of the boat, motor, occupants, supplies and all the other stuff that you will have on the boat?

    This was a problem area for me. Since i don't know proper boat building techniques and Im designing as I go, I couldnt really figure a way to estimate empty build weight. Ive got things planned to be able to be completed in phases. I laid out the general phases assuming I would have no outside advice and would need to test as i went. So, phase 1 (current) involved sealing the skeleton (cheap ply) with as many coats of CPES/git rot/ or thinned epoxy as necessary for the end grains to stop soaking. Skin and seal with glass cloth/epoxy/varnish. Get some buddies to help spot it so I don't drop it and then get it up on my shoulders like I was portaging the canoe. This would give me a point close to cb. then float test it; ballast the rear for motor weight and set ballast where I guesstimate beam location to be. Then adjust as necessary. I have figured what I believe to be conservative buoyancy calculations. I didn't take all of the angled areas volumes and didn't count the front 5 ft where the height changes are. I am coming out with around 1500 pounds at 10" draft. I have been reading alot of the cat stuff but most of it applies to the sailing cats. So, I see with them that your max load should be equal to the buoyancy of one hull. This appears to be because of waves and/or one side lifting due to the force of the wind on the sails. So minus the sails and considering this subject to small craft advisories, it seems like I would be okay to figure a max overall load of 1.5x one hull. 2,250 pounds at 10" draft with about 12" of freeboard. Again, no exp here, so i planned to modify the topside design to accomadte for the weights and drafts I was seeing at the point. So if the draft started getting to deep to early in the build, the cabins (lol, theyre small, more like coffins) would go from hardtop to ragtop, etc.

    ElGringo,

    Yeah, I couldn't find anything like that either. The closest I came was a couple cross section pics that really surprised me. I think one of the pics was from a build page of a Wood's Wizard or Merlin. I was expecting solid beam but they appeared to be hollow. With solid wood top and bottom and ply front and backs. When I got to that point I was going to look and see if I could find any data related to the stresses put on the beam. I'm thinking I would need figures for up/down, left/right, and rotational. I was then going to apply what I know about the resistances the wood has and come up with a solid wood beam. If i detect any unwanted flex during testing, I can rout some places to insert some box tubing or square stock aluminum to reinforce.
